How do I add a header or footer in Google Docs?

Answer

To insert headers and footers in your doc, click the Insert drop-down menu and click Headers & footers. Then, select either Header or Footer and type the text for your header or footer in the area within dotted lines.

To hide your header or footer, delete all the contents from it. Then, click anywhere in the main document editing space to continue working.
